Financial markets often respond to chaos in unexpected ways. The stock market rallied after a US presidential contender was shot at, but this doesn’t necessarily indicate a political impact on companies’ bottom lines. While some traders believe the incident could improve the contender’s chances of winning, others doubled down on so-called Trump trades. Volatile stocks like Trump Media and Bitcoin benefited, as did companies like Tesla and gun makers. However, sectors like solar energy and cannabis saw a decline. Bond traders also indicated a slight shift in expectations for a second Trump presidency, as Treasury bond yields rose.
